PUPPETS

Presented by: Ben Raju


DEFINITION:

Puppet are inanimate figures or subject


manipulated by a puppeteer to create the illusion
of movement and speech. The primary motive of
using puppet to educate the student
CHARACTERISTICS:

• Manipulation: puppet are typically controlled by a puppeteer who


uses strings, rods, or their hands to manipulate the movement of the
puppet

• Representation: puppet represent character or object often with a


artistic interpretation.

• Medium: they can be made from various material including fabric,


wood, clay, and even metals.

• Voice or Sound: some puppet are equipped with mechanism for


producing sound while other relay on the puppeteer
PURPOSE:

• Motivate students

• Puppet are valuable tool for education

• They create interest

• Puppet can be used as a medium for communication and self expression

• Puppet can employed in advertising and marketing campaign to capture


attention
TYPES OF PUPPETS:

• String or Marionette Puppet : marionettes consists of puppet with hinged body


parts which are controlled by strings producing the required movement in the
puppet

• Stick Puppet: They are painted cut-outs attached by stick. Action of these
puppet are controlled by puppeteer by hiding behind a screen

• Shadow Puppet: They are outline of cardboard that produce shadows on a


white screen.

• Finger Puppets : Hand puppets are round balls painted as heads with over
flowing, colourful costumes.

ADVANTAGES :

• They create interest

• They give knowledge in a brief period

• They are an effective method in teaching

• They motivate student.

• They are easy to carry and operate


LIMITATIONS:

• They need group coordination and cooperation

• They required skills in preparation and supply

• Skills are needed for presentation
